CVS Carepass is only $5 a month. Each month get a $10 CVS carepass reward. It automatically loads right to your CVS card each month on the same day. So right there it pays for itself. You can use your $10 CVS Carepass reward on almost anything in the store (not prescriptions ). It’s almost like getting a $10 gift card every month. Also your $10 CVS Carepass rewards stacks with sales, coupons, etc. So like I said, almost like a gift card.

Another benefits to CVS Carepass? 20% off CVS Health Brand products and Live Better Products every day. It’s nice to save 20% off CVS Health Brand products when I need to grab bandaids or tummy medicines or feminine products.

CVS will occasionally offer freebies for Carepass members too that will load to your card. You can also get free 1-2 shipping when at least one Carepass eligible item is added to your order. (Some other restrictions may apply)
